Why laser jobs are easy to underquote
A blank that costs three dollars can still require proofing, material tests, jigs, focus and framing, repeated loading, cleaning, finishing, packaging, and customer communication. Machine time also needs to recover the laser, optics, maintenance, exhaust, and electricity. This model separates each cost instead of hiding everything inside an arbitrary price-per-minute.
Failure is modeled at the run level
If six tumblers share one jig and the run fails, the risk is not one-sixth of a blank. The calculator converts your observed run failure rate into expected repeat attempts, lost blanks, repeated machine time, and repeated operator time.
Laser job pricing questions
Should artwork time be charged once or per item?
Usually once per order. The calculator treats artwork and proofing as order-level labor while finishing is per finished item.
What belongs in machine cost?
Depreciation, maintenance, filters or exhaust, and electricity. Rent and general overhead can be entered as another direct order cost or reflected in your margin policy.
